Skip to content

Commit 41e4adb

Browse files
committed
ci: применить миграции перед alembic check
- В CI сначала выполняется alembic upgrade head - Затем запускается alembic check для контроля drift
1 parent 9701455 commit 41e4adb

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

.github/workflows/ci.yml

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-79,6 +79,9 @@ jobs:
7979
- name: Install dependencies
8080
run: uv sync --frozen --dev
8181

82+
- name: Apply Alembic migrations
83+
run: uv run alembic upgrade head
84+
8285
- name: Check Alembic drift
8386
run: uv run alembic check
8487

0 commit comments

Comments
 (0)